<p><strong>1.Job Summary:</strong></p><p>We are seeking a skilled and highly organized Bid Engineer to join our team at OCC Weavers Ltd. The Bid Engineer will play a crucial role in the construction bidding process, working closely with the Estimating team to prepare and submit competitive bids for construction projects. The ideal candidate will have a strong technical background, excellent analytical skills, and a thorough understanding of the construction industry.</p><p> </p><p><strong>2.Responsibilities:</strong></p><p>- Collaborate with the Estimating team to review project requirements, plans, and specifications to develop comprehensive bid proposals.</p><p>- Conduct thorough cost analysis and prepare accurate cost estimates for labor, materials, equipment, subcontractors, and other project-related expenses.</p><p>- Coordinate with various departments and subcontractors to gather necessary information for bid preparation, including pricing, scope of work, and project schedules.</p><p>- Conduct market research to identify potential suppliers, subcontractors, and vendors, and solicit competitive quotes.</p><p>- Prepare and submit bid packages, ensuring compliance with client requirements and deadlines.</p><p>- Review bid documents and contracts to identify potential risks, ambiguities, or discrepancies and provide recommendations for mitigating such risks.</p><p>- Participate in pre-bid meetings, site visits, and other client interactions to gain a comprehensive understanding of project requirements and client expectations.</p><p>- Stay updated with industry trends, market conditions, and regulatory changes that may impact bidding strategies and construction project costs.</p><p>- Maintain accurate and organized records of bid documents, correspondence, and related information.</p><p> </p><p><strong>3.Qualifications</strong>:</p><p>- Bachelor’s degree in Civil Engineering, Construction Management, or a related field.</p><p>- Proven experience as a Bid Engineer or in a similar role within the construction industry.</p><p>- Strong knowledge of construction estimating techniques, including quantity take-offs, cost analysis, and pricing strategies.</p><p>- Proficiency in bid preparation software (CANDY) and Microsoft Office Suite.</p><p>- Excellent analytical and problem-solving skills, with attention to detail.</p><p>- Strong communication and interpersonal skills, with the ability to collaborate effectively with internal teams and external stakeholders.</p><p>- Knowledge of construction contracts, specifications, and legal requirements.</p><p>- Familiarity with industry standards, codes, and regulations.</p><p>- Professional certifications or affiliations related to bidding and estimating (e.g., Certified Professional Estimator) are desirable.</p>
